智能对话系统的多语言翻译技术详解

智能对话系统的多语言翻译技术详解

在当今全球化的时代,语言的障碍已经成为人们沟通和交流的巨大挑战。随着信息技术的飞速发展,智能对话系统应运而生,而多语言翻译技术则是这些系统的心脏。本文将深入探讨智能对话系统的多语言翻译技术,并通过一个具体的故事来展示这项技术在现实中的应用。

故事的主角名叫李华,是一名来自中国的留学生。李华在美国的一所大学攻读硕士学位,由于他的专业课程涉及跨文化交流,因此经常需要与来自不同国家的同学和教授进行沟通。然而,语言的差异使得他在日常交流中遇到了不少困难。

一开始,李华试图通过字典和在线翻译工具来解决沟通问题,但这些工具的翻译准确性往往不够高,有时甚至会导致误解。例如,一次在讨论学术问题时,他试图用翻译工具将“跨文化适应”翻译成英语,结果得到了“cross-cultural adaptability”的错误翻译。当他向教授解释时,教授误以为他在说“交叉文化的适应性”,导致讨论出现了偏差。

在一次偶然的机会中,李华听说了一款名为“智能对话系统”的应用,该系统能够实现实时、准确的跨语言交流。他怀着试一试的心态下载了这款应用,并惊喜地发现,它的多语言翻译功能确实如宣传所说,翻译准确率极高。

为了验证智能对话系统的翻译能力,李华尝试用它来翻译一篇学术文章。他将中文文章输入系统,系统迅速将其翻译成英文,并给出了多个可选的翻译结果。李华仔细比较了这些结果,发现它们都非常贴近原文的意思,而且用词准确,语法通顺。这次经历让他对智能对话系统的翻译技术产生了浓厚的兴趣。

为了更深入地了解智能对话系统的多语言翻译技术,李华开始研究相关的技术文档和学术论文。他发现,这种技术主要基于以下三个方面:

  1. 语言模型:智能对话系统中的语言模型是翻译的核心,它负责理解和生成语言。目前,常用的语言模型有循环神经网络(RNN)、长短期记忆网络(LSTM)和Transformer等。这些模型能够捕捉到语言的上下文信息,从而提高翻译的准确性。

  2. 翻译算法:翻译算法是智能对话系统中的另一个关键组成部分,它决定了如何将源语言转换为目标语言。目前,常见的翻译算法有基于规则的方法、基于统计的方法和基于深度学习的方法。其中,基于深度学习的方法在近年来取得了显著的成果。

  3. 机器学习:机器学习是智能对话系统多语言翻译技术的基础,它使得系统能够通过不断学习大量的语料库来提高翻译质量。常用的机器学习方法包括监督学习、无监督学习和半监督学习等。

在深入了解这些技术之后,李华意识到,智能对话系统的多语言翻译技术并非简单的语言转换,而是一个复杂的系统工程。它需要结合多种先进的技术,如自然语言处理、人工智能、大数据等,才能实现高质量、高效率的翻译。

随着对智能对话系统多语言翻译技术的深入研究,李华决定将这项技术应用到他的毕业设计中。他设计了一个基于智能对话系统的跨文化交流平台,该平台能够帮助来自不同国家的用户实现无障碍沟通。在他的努力下,这个平台成功吸引了大量用户,并获得了广泛的好评。

故事中的李华通过自己的实践,展示了智能对话系统多语言翻译技术的强大功能。这项技术不仅能够解决跨文化交流中的语言障碍,还能为人们的生活带来更多便利。随着技术的不断进步,我们有理由相信,智能对话系统的多语言翻译技术将会在未来发挥更加重要的作用。

猜你喜欢:AI语音对话